Stress and anxiety are not all bad. In fact, they can become a super power at times. When they are unhelpful and problematic, though, we can learn new habits that can change our neurochemicals and our emotions and transform that inner dialogue!
Adolescence is by nature stressful because there is so much change and uncertainty - often invisible stuff - happening in our brains and bodies.
